browser displays images bigger than original size


my web site displays images bigger than their original size. The images are 20% bigger than the original created with photoshop (for example), if an image's width is 200px, the browser display is 240px.

So all my images are blured.

Do you know why?


Solution

  • I've found the solution!

    Windows 10 has the default setting of dpi seted to 125% (search dpi into serach box and then look at "update text app and other elements"), this increase the dimension of everything in my monitor, so the images into my web site are bigger of 25%.
